What on earth does this have to do with tomato castles? Well it was these tomato castles that I made after we had finished sorting through our mess of groceries!

Ingredients:

4-5 oz mozzarella, thinly sliced

1 large tomato, thinly sliced

1 avocado, thinly sliced

1/8 small red onion, thinly sliced (just a few slivers for each layer)

2 tablespoons olive oil

1/2 teaspoon ground ginger

1/4 teaspoon black pepper

2 teaspoons cilantro, chopped

1/2 teaspoon honey

2 tablespoons lemon juice

salt, to taste

 

Directions:

1.Combine olive oil, ginger, pepper, cilantro, honey, lemon juice and salt.  Set aside.

2. On a plate layer tomato slice, mozzarella slice, avocado slice, and red onion slice. Repeat 1 or 2 more times. Drizzle mixture on top of tomato castles.  Garnish with fresh basil leaves.
